Price-Volume Granger Causality Tests in the Egyptian Stock Exchange (EGX)
Using weekly Egyptian stock exchange data on the 34 most active companies stretching from 2011 to 2017, this study finds that price changes Granger cause trading volume up to 8 weeks (lags), supporting the sequential information arrival model in the EGX.
